Output 8364ca3945959243c36419033096f4af73e50186f92658c5dd1deda382d93eb2:4

value
75494436
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ca8fd1d641ddfc97a52bcc4b27706cb668dc101ff017be96f19b5ae26149126
address
bc1p8j5068tyrh0uj7jjhnztyacxedngmsgpluqhh6t0rx66ufs5jynqmka2m6
transaction
8364ca3945959243c36419033096f4af73e50186f92658c5dd1deda382d93eb2
spent
true